I want to work in a school but not teaching, I'm after a behaviour area or inclusion support, possibly admissions.
What kind of qualifications do I need for that?

However, the inclusion/pastoral support workers at my old school were usually people with experience of life, maybe ex policemen/military or ex teachers or teaching assistants with a variety of qualifications. GSCE or equivalent English and maths are a given, though.
